Abstract
Wireless Sensor Networks (WSN) can be deployed in a non-intrusive way in outdoor and indoor environments, due its reduced size and wireless communication media. Some networks are deployed in hazardous and inaccessible places where change of battery is either prohibitive or an expensive solution. This way, energy economy is one of the most important characteristic in a WSN approach. In this paper, is presented DPAWSN -- a decentralized power aware approach for data fusion applications in WSN. Test results based in real motes implementation confirm the approach effectiveness.
